There's 12 Fire-type Pokemon in the initial 151 Pokemon that includes in Pokemon Go. That's Charmander, Charmeleon, Charizard, Vulpix, Ninetales, Growlithe, Arcanine, Ponyta, Rapidash, Magmar, Flareon and Moltres. Some of these will only be readily available via development, and as a legendary the best ways to obtain Moltres stays a secret.

There's 22 Normal-type Pokemon in the original 151 Pokemon that features in Pokemon Go. That includes: Pidgey, Pidgeotto, Pidgeot, Rattata, Raticate, Spearow, Fearow, Jigglypuff, Wigglytuff, Meowth, Persian, Farfetch 'd, Doduo, Dodrio, Lickitung, Chansey, Kangaskhan, Tauros, Ditto, Eevee, Porygon, and Snorlax. Keep in mind that some Pokemon are only available by means of advancement.

Seeing rustling leaves on your map? That's not simply artistic style-- it's an indication that a wild Pokémon is nearby! What sort of Pokémon? It's never ever totally clear, but you can get a smart idea of exactly what it is based on the menu in the lower right of the primary screen.

Beyond just revealing you which Pokémon are in your basic location, it also informs you how close they are to you. One footprint is fairly close-- a brief walk-- while several footprints indicate you may have a bit of a hike prior to discovering that particular pocket beast.

Bear in mind that fashionable doctor who works as the property for the whole of "Pokémon GO?" His name is Professor Willow, and he desires your Pokémon. Fortunately is you're going to catch a lot of duplicates. And those duplicates can then be transferred to Professor Willow by choosing them in the Pokémon menu (click the Pokéball, then click the Pokémon submenu), scrolling down, and picking "Transfer." For your present, Dr. Willow will hook you up with some candy for that Pokémon. Which candy can be utilized to make your Pokémon stronger, or to evolve them!

There are two crucial elements of Pokemon GO that make the magic take place-- a data connection and location services on your gadget. The latter, nevertheless, indicates that Pokemon GO requires a clear GPS signal to operate appropriately. When there's no GPS signal, the game will instantly toss a 'GPS Signal Not Found' error message at you, rendering your gameplay essentially ineffective.
